I have my first wit in the kettle. Refractometer readings are showing I have 33L of 14 Brix wort. My preboil target is 33L of 10 Brix wort. By my calculations, I need to dilute with 11L of water?

Don't think I can fit that much in the kettle, I can always drain some out and recalc the dilution, but I am concerned something is up with this recipie. I used Pilsner Malt, Rolled Oats and White Flour.

I normally get 65-70% efficiency. Is the Flour the reason for the high efficiency?
 
For that sort of ratio calculation, you need to convert brix to kg extract per Hl

33lx14.8/10.4 =47l

14 litres of makeup water required.
